Today, June 27, is the anniversary of the departure of the 18-year-old Muharram Fouad, who is considered one of the most famous stars of beautiful time.

Fouad was born on June 25, 1934, and the great director Henri Barakat presented it in the movie “Hassan and Naima” in front of Souad Hosni. It was then twenty-five years old, and he presented nearly 900 songs, 13 cinematographic films, and two singing plays during his artistic career.

In singing, Muharram Fouad collaborated with composer Baligh Hamdi, who was like a brother and friend for him since childhood, as well as musician Farid al-Atrash, who loved his songs from a young age.

Death

Muharram Fouad died on June 27, 2002, with a heart attack, at the age of 68.
